Unlocking Inspirational Leadership: Key Attributes for Success

Inspirational leaders are acknowledged for their ability to motivate and guide others toward a shared objective. While there is no single formula for achieving this, certain key attributes often distinguish these influential individuals.

First and foremost, inspirational leaders possess a deep sense of honesty. They reflect their values in their actions, building trust and respect among their followers. Furthermore, they are exceptional speakers, able to articulate their ideas with precision and fervor.

Nurturing a positive and supportive environment is also paramount. Inspirational leaders promote collaboration, celebrate individual contributions, and offer opportunities for growth and development. Finally, they demonstrate unwavering persistence, tackling challenges with confidence.

These attributes, when cultivated and integrated into leadership practices, can revolutionize teams and organizations, paving the way for extraordinary results.
